Version 3.3.0 revamps how sanctions are handled on your Discord server with the introduction of the Sanctions History β a complete system to track, manage, and analyze all moderation actions.

π A Complete Record for Every Sanctionβ
Keep track of every moderation action with the new Sanctions History. Never wonder again who was sanctioned, when, or why:
- Automatic centralization: Bans, kicks, timeouts, and automod sanctions are recorded automatically.
- Advanced search with
/sanctions search: Instantly retrieve a memberβs history. - Full details with
/sanctions info: View all information on a specific sanction. - Flexible editing with
/sanctions edit: Correct a reason or adjust an existing sanction. - Deletion or reversal with
/sanctions delete: Undo a sanction or remove it from history if needed. - Smart sanction status management
Every sanction now generates a confirmation indicating whether the member received the notification via DM.
β‘ New Moderation Toolsβ
This update also expands your moderation toolkit with three essential new commands:
/tempban: Temporarily ban a member for a set duration./warn: Warn a member with full traceability in the history./untimeout: Remove a timeout before it expires.
π‘οΈ Improved RaidMode and JoinLockβ
The anti-raid system is now smarter and more flexible:
- Automatic deactivation: RaidMode and Auto RaidMode turn off automatically after a set time β no more forgotten settings!
- Duration setting: Set the duration directly when activating with
/raidmode. - New
/joinlockcommand: Close invites indefinitely for full control over new arrivals. - Acknowledgment for Minimum Age: Receive confirmation that the member received the explanatory message.
